In a slurry pump, the impeller, volute, and frame usually get the most attention. But behind every stable, long-lasting, and efficient pump, there are many small and medium-sized components quietly doing the hard work. Even though these parts may look simple, they directly affect the pump’s sealing performance, service life, and maintenance cost.
Among them, the seals, lantern ring, and grease retainer play especially critical roles.
1. Seal – The First Line of Defense Against Leakage
Seals ensure that the slurry does not leak along the shaft and damage the bearing assembly. A good sealing system prevents:
Slurry infiltration into the bearing housing
Wear and corrosion on the shaft sleeve
Unplanned downtime due to leakage
Loss of pump efficiency
Different pumps may use packing seals, mechanical seals, or expeller seals, but they all serve one purpose: protect the pump from leakage under harsh working conditions. Even slight damage or improper installation of a seal can lead to major failures.
2. Lantern Ring – The Hidden Guardian Inside the Packing
The lantern ring is a small ring installed inside the packing set, often made of brass or stainless steel.
Although tiny, its functions are very important:
Distributes flushing water evenly around the packing
Reduces friction between the packing and the shaft sleeve
Keeps the packing lubricated so it doesn’t burn out
Helps build a stable seal pressure zone
Without a properly placed lantern ring, the packing seal will fail prematurely, causing:
Overheating
Excessive wear
Leakage
Shaft sleeve damage
This small part directly determines the working life of the packing seal.
3. Grease Retainer – Protecting the Bearings From Contamination
The grease retainer is another medium-sized component with big responsibility. Its job is to:
Keep grease inside the bearing housing
Prevent slurry, moisture, and dust from entering
Maintain stable lubrication for long bearing life
Slurry pumps operate in extremely dirty environments. Once contaminants enter the bearings, failures happen quickly — including overheating, vibration, and bearing collapse. The grease retainer ensures the bearings stay clean and protected, greatly extending the pump’s reliability.
